WebbSHARP PRACTICE meaning, definition in Cambridge English Dictionary sharp practice definition: 1. a way of behaving, in business, that is dishonest but not illegal: 2. a way of … Webbsharp 1 of 4 adjective ˈshärp Synonyms of sharp 1 : adapted to cutting or piercing: such as a : having a thin keen edge or fine point b : briskly or bitingly cold : nipping a sharp wind 2 … Webb9 aug. 2024 · sharp (n.) "a cheat at games," 1797, short for sharper (1680s) in this sense. Meaning "an expert, a connoisseur" is attested from 1840, and likely is from sharp (adj.). Musical sense of "a tone a half-step above a given tone" is from 1590s; as the name of the character which denotes this, by 1650s. impact ironworks surrey

Webb1 feb. 2024 · The Sharpe Ratio is a measure of risk-adjusted return, which compares an investment's excess return to its standard deviation of returns. The Sharpe Ratio is commonly used to gauge the performance of an investment by adjusting for its risk.

Webb25 juli 2015 · In C++, using the _var convention is bad form, because there are rules governing the use of the underscore in front of an identifier. _var is reserved as a global identifier, while _Var (underscore + capital letter) is reserved anytime. This is why in C++, you'll see people using the var_ convention instead. Share.
